A contemporary dining chair featuring a light-colored wooden frame and upholstered seat and backrest. The frame consists of straight, slightly tapered square legs and a minimalist structure. The seat is a rectangular upholstered cushion, and the backrest is formed by a wide, taut fabric strap attached to the uprights of the frame. The fabric appears to be a textured, light beige or cream color, complementing the natural tone of the wood. — 3D model

What type of wood is typically used for this chair's frame?
Chairs with this aesthetic commonly utilize light-colored hardwoods such as oak, ash, or beech, chosen for their durability, fine grain, and ability to be finished in natural tones.

What is the standard seat height of this dining chair?
A standard dining chair typically has a seat height ranging from 17.5 to 19 inches (44-48 cm), designed to comfortably fit under most dining tables, which are usually 29-30 inches high.
